Command: cal - print a calendar
|
|
Syntax: cal [month] year
|
|
Flags: (none)
|
|
Example: cal 3 1992 # Print March 1992
|
|
|
|
Cal prints a calendar for a month or year. The year can be between
|
|
1 and 9999. Note that the year 91 is not a synonym for 1991, but is
|
|
itself a valid year about 19 centuries ago. The calendar produced is
|
|
the one used by England and her colonies. Try Sept. 1752, Feb 1900, and
|
|
Feb 2000. If you do not understand what is going on, look up Calendar,
|
|
Gregorian in a good encyclopedia.
